Holiday beef recipes that make the season simple

The holiday season often means a full calendar and even fuller grocery lists, making meal planning more important than ever. Whether you’re planning a full menu for the celebration of the season or repurposing leftovers, the “Beef. It’s What’s For Dinner.” brand, funded by beef farmers, has the recipes you need to beef up any plans you have in mind for the holidays.

 

If you have family and friends coming over for breakfast, a Beef & Veggie Quiche is both an easy and tasty way to start the day. The combination of seasoned ground beef, vegetables and cheese inside a flaky pie crust creates a comforting dish that feels special for the holiday – but is simple and can also be made ahead of time.

 

Looking for a crowd-pleasing appetizer that’s just as simple for later in the day? Mini Lasagna Bites offer the same classic comfort of traditional lasagna but are perfect for party guests wanting to mingle. Just line a mini muffin pan with cooked pieces of lasagna noodles before adding your ground beef mixture and cheese’s – and that’s it!

 

For those planning a traditional rib roast as your holiday dinner centerpiece, make sure you have enough for leftovers so you can enjoy this Prime Rib Pasta with Broccoli and Cheese. After cutting your prime rib into bite-sized pieces, cook up some pasta then toss everything together with sun-dried tomatoes and truffle oil. A speedy weeknight dinner with all the glam and flavor of the holidays.
